Bison Oil & Gas is a Denver-based upstream oil and gas exploration and production company committed to pursuing value through responsible oil and gas development that ensures maximum benefits to both shareholders and stakeholders by operating intelligently, ethically, responsibly, and on the cutting edge of technology.

Bison Oil & Gas IV operates in the DJ Basin of Colorado and Wyoming. Bison has operated in the DJ since 2015 and currently operates over 300,000 net acres, 400 wells, and ~30,000 BOE of production per day. Bison is a leading modern operator that strives to operate with the least possible impact on the environment and our surrounding communities. Bison is the largest private operator in the DJ Basin.

Summary

The Surface Landman is responsible for supporting the acquisition, permitting, and management of surface-related agreements and operations. This role involves securing Surface Use Agreements (SUAs), conducting land title analysis, negotiating basic agreements, and maintaining positive relationships with landowners and regulatory agencies. The Surface Landman works closely with internal teams, ensures compliance with relevant regulations, and helps resolve landowner issues to ensure smooth surface operations.

Job Responsibilities and Essential Functions
  • Assist in securing Surface Use Agreements (SUAs) and other necessary surface-related agreements with landowners.
  • Conduct research using company and public records to identify land ownership and assist in title verification processes.
  • Review and analyze land titles to identify discrepancies and work with senior team members to outline corrective actions.
  • Help negotiate surface agreements with landowners, draft documentation, and assist in coordinating the review and execution process.
  • Review land-related agreements, amendments, deeds, easements, leases, permits, and licenses under the guidance of senior land management staff.
  • Collaborate with internal departments (such as legal, operations, and engineering) to help ensure necessary agreements are in place for operational needs.
  • Maintain communication with internal teams, landowners, and regulatory agencies to ensure smooth operations and positive working relationships.
  • Assist in addressing landowner concerns, help resolve disputes and elevate issues to senior team members when necessary.
  • Support the management of encroachments, damage claims, and property damage settlements related to surface operations.
  • Help manage notification requirements, including certified USPS mail and hand deliveries to landowners.
  • Work alongside field personnel to address landowner concerns and ensure operational efficiency.
  • Assist in coordinating with reclamation teams and regulatory bodies to meet environmental and operational standards.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
